Low Energy HVAC

Maintain a year-round habitable environment and maximising occupant health, wellbeing, and productivity at lower cost and higher efficiencies.

The heating, ventilation, and cooling (HVAC) of all buildings is critical to maintain a year-round habitable environment and maximising occupant health, wellbeing, and productivity. The hidden ductwork, piping, and management of energy flow around our modern buildings is becoming ever more important and working to reduce energy usage is the next frontier.

At Mesh, intelligent design of low energy HVAC is an aspect of building design we pride ourselves on. We offer nuanced sizing, routing, placement, and controls to ensure a lasting reduction in energy usage throughout the system.
